## Tuning clock skew tolerance

The Lathework build farm syncs agent clocks hourly, but drift between syncs can reach a few hundred milliseconds, which breaks artifact freshness checks that compare timestamps across agents. Rather than fail hard, the scheduler applies a skew allowance when ordering build events, plus a backoff for agents whose drift exceeds the soft limit. Reviewers should confirm any change here against the drift histograms from last quarter. The current tolerances are as follows.

constants for tahof-kafop:
CAPS = {
    "siliel": 406,
    "silael": 168,
    "rusath": 492,
    "noveth": 652,
    "ulaion": 1020,
}

**Checklist — incremental rebuilds (Pagegrove 2.8)**

Confirm the incremental rebuild path invalidates only pages whose content hashes changed; full rebuilds should trigger solely on template edits. Spot-check the Thornlea docs site: a single-page edit must finish under ten seconds. Results recorded against the build identified below:

session token of yajof-bagef = htk4_937d

Rebuildlet watches content changes and rebuilds only affected pages of the Marrowgate docs site. Support staff adjusting environments should know: REBUILD_CONCURRENCY caps parallel page builds (default 4), and CACHE_ROOT must point at persistent storage or every rebuild becomes a full build. Stale-page purges are throttled by PURGE_INTERVAL_SECONDS. The rebuild worker also authenticates to the content API on startup, and that call fails closed without its token. Place the token assignment on the next line:

secret setting of yajog-taguf: ARCHIVE_KEY3=051